MORNING MANNA         12/4/19

December 4, 2019 By Pastor David Stone

“And you hath he quickened, who were dead in trespasses and sins;” – Eph. 2:1

“Even when we were dead in sins, hath quickened us together with Christ, (by grace ye are saved;” – Eph. 2:5

“But now in Christ Jesus ye who sometimes were far off are made nigh by the blood of Christ.” – Eph. 2:13

Trying to describe a sinner’s awful condition can be difficult because they have no understanding of God’s Word. They don’t realize what a terrible peril their unbelief puts them in. Tell them they are spiritually dead and they look at you like a calf looking at a new gate and assume you are crazy. But they don’t know what they don’t know. That reminds me of the story about the little boy who lived on a farm. One day he watched his dad cut a chicken’s head off and the chicken continued to jump, run, and flop around. The little boy said to his father, “Look daddy, he’s dead and doesn’t know it!”. Even so, the same could be said of lost sinners.

Years ago an old time open-air preacher was conducting a service when a young man cried out, “You tell us about the burden of sin, but I don’t feel any such burden! How much does sin weigh? 80 pounds? 10 pounds?” The wise preacher replied, “Tell me, if you laid a 400 pound weight on the chest of a dead man, would he feel it?” The young fellow said, “No, because he is dead”. The preacher then responded, “And the man who feels no load of sin is dead spiritually”.

Even so, regardless of how you feel, what you think, or what you’ve been told, without Christ you are spiritually dead. In other words you are separated from God. The good news is that Jesus said, “I am come that they might have life, and that they might have it more abundantly.” ( John 10:10). Thank God that it true! What Jesus promised He provided. Due to His death, burial, and resurrection, eternal life is available for all who believe. As John the Baptist said, “He that believeth on the Son hath everlasting life: and he that believeth not the Son shall not see life; but the wrath of God abideth on him.” ( John 3:36). So, are you dead or alive? – HDS
